Bees are smarter than MAGAts - Honeybees Use Social Distancing When Mites Threaten Hives
............
By examining videos recorded inside the hives, the team found that when the hive is infested with mites, foraging bees which tend to be older members of the colony performed important dances to indicate the direction of food sources, such as the waggle dance, away from the centre of the colony where the young bees, the queen and brood cells are found.
That, said Cini, may help to keep the infection at a level that can be controlled, limiting the amount of damage. Foragers are one of the main entrance routes for the mites, said Cini. So the more they stay away from the brood and the young individuals, the better it is in terms of preventing the spread of the mites within the colony.
.............
Cini said the study showed the power of natural selection in the evolution of social behaviour. And also dynamic change in the social behaviour to adapt to an ever-changing environment, he said.

!2 California condor chicks have hatched from unfertilized eggs!
🚨BREAKING NEWS🚨
Scientists at SDZWA discovered two California condor chicks have hatched from unfertilized eggs. This sort of asexual reproduction, known as parthenogenesis, is a first for the species and provides new hope for their recovery. Read more: http://sdzwa.org/condorchicks

The legislative process is rarely pretty. It highlights political divisions and can feel disconnected from peoples lives. When a big bill is making its way through Congress, voters are often turned off.
The central piece of President Bidens agenda has followed the pattern. It has caused squabbles among Democrats, and the plan has already shrunk nearly by half, disappointing progressives, amusing Republicans and providing grist for critical media coverage.
Eventually, though, the process behind a bills passage tends to fade into history. What matters far more is a bills substance. And if Congress passes anything resembling the legislative framework that Biden announced yesterday, it will be highly consequential.
That was the main message I heard from policy experts yesterday when I asked them to assess the framework. Compared with Bidens original proposal, it looks paltry. Compared with the status quo, it looks like a big deal.
